Venue description

Danish Architecture Center (DAC) is an international cultural attraction for everyone who wants to explore how architecture and design create the framework for our lives. We believe that architecture can change the world and that it can be part of the solution to future challenges in relation to the UN Global Goals. DAC is a not-for-profit foundation. Our core funding is provided by a public-private partnership between the Danish government and the philanthropic association Realdania. The Danish government is represented by the Ministry of Industry, Business and Financial Affairs, the Ministry of Culture, and the Ministry of Social Affairs, Housing and Senior Citizens.
